If you're looking to hire a photographer for product photography on Amazon, there are a few options available to you. Here are some possible steps you can take:

1. Consider whether you want to hire a professional photographer or do the photography yourself. If you have the skills and equipment, you can certainly take product photos on your own. However, if you want high-quality photos that will make your products stand out on Amazon, it's worth considering hiring a professional photographer.



2. Look for Amazon photographer online. You can search on websites for freelancers who specialize in product photography. Alternatively, you can search for photography studios in your area that offer product photography services.

3. Review the photographer's portfolio. Before you hire a photographer, it's important to review their portfolio to make sure their style of photography matches the look you want for your products. Look for examples of their past work with products similar to yours.

4. Discuss the details of the photoshoot. Once you find a photographer you like, make sure to discuss the details of the photoshoot, such as the number of products to be photographed, the types of shots you want (e.g., white background, lifestyle, etc.), and any specific requirements you may have.

5. Agree on pricing and delivery. Make sure to agree on pricing and delivery before the photoshoot begins. This should include the total cost, any deposit required, and a timeline for when the photos will be delivered to you.

Overall, hiring a professional photographer for your Amazon product photography can be a worthwhile investment if you want high-quality photos that will help your products stand out on the platform.
